نمایش نتایج 1 تا 5 از 5

نام تاپیک: ماندن در یاد مرورگر

  1. #1

    ماندن در یاد مرورگر

    سلام
    به این نوشته ی نگا بندازید.
    استادمون ازمون ی پروژه واسه drag و drop کردن اشیائ خواسته بود.
    حالا من پروژه رو نوشتم و ب خوبی کار میکنه.
    ب متن زیر نگا بندازید،فقط این قسمت از پروژم مونده


    • تمامی اطلاعات و تغییرات ذخیره شده و در صورت بستن و باز نمودن مجدد مرورگر همان وضعیت قبلی برنامه نمایش داده شود، این اطلاعات باید سمت سرویس گیرنده ذخیره شوند


    منظورش اینه که اشیاء در هرکجا drop شوندو قرار گیرند با بستن و باز کردن دوباره مرورگر در در جای خود ثابت مانده و ب حالت اولیه باز نگردد.
    من چیزی که ب ذهنم میرسه اینه که هنگام بستن پنجره کل سورس صفحه رو در یک چیزی مثل کوکی یا هرچیزی دخیره کنم و بار دیگر که پنجره باز شد همون کد های ذخیره شده رو جایگزین کد صفحه بکنم؟
    میشه در مورد چگونگی انجام این کار ی کوچولو راهنماییم کنید؟
    چ راه هایی ب نظرتون میرسه واسه انجام این کار؟
    ممنون میشم

  2. #2
    کاربر دائمی آواتار 2undercover
    تاریخ عضویت
    تیر 1391
    محل زندگی
    خراسان رضوی
    پست
    1,471

    نقل قول: ماندن در یاد مرورگر

    راهی که توی بیشتر مرورگر ها جواب میده همون Cookie هست که می تونید اطلاعات رو اول encode کنید و توی cookie ذخیره کنید.
    راه دوم که مدرن تر هست استفاده از Web storage هست. HTML5 Web Storage API

  3. #3

    نقل قول: ماندن در یاد مرورگر

    تشکر فراوان بابت راهنمایی ها
    چند تا سوال داشتم در این مورد:
    من راه دوم رو انتخاب کردم و راه مدرن تر.
    حالا
    میشه بگید چ جوری میتونم کد های کل صفحم رو فراخوانی کنم و encode کنم .
    حاالا چ طوری کد های قبلی رو جایگزین کد های جدید کنم.منظورم اینه که با چ تابعی ب کد های کل صفحه دسترسی داشته باشم و بتونم اون رو حذف و اضافه کنم.
    ممنون

  4. #4

    نقل قول: ماندن در یاد مرورگر

    امیدوارم منظورمو متوجه شده باش.
    منظورم این بود که با چ تابعی کد های صفحم رو در یک تابع قرار داده و اونرو encode کنم.
    و
    با چه تابعی کد هایی را که در مرورگر قرار داشته را جایگزین کد های جدید کنم؟
    ممنون بابت راهنمایی هاتون

  5. #5
    کاربر دائمی آواتار 2undercover
    تاریخ عضویت
    تیر 1391
    محل زندگی
    خراسان رضوی
    پست
    1,471

    نقل قول: ماندن در یاد مرورگر

    می تونید اینطوری کل محتویات صفحه رو بدست بیارید و با استفاده از این روش اون را با استفاده از base64 کد کنید و ذخیره بکنید و بالعکس دوباره اون رو به حالت قبل برگردونید و محتویات صفحه رو سر جاش قرار بدید:


    document.getElementsByTagName('html').innerHTML;

تاپیک های مشابه

  1. سوال: ثابت ماندن شکل و اندازه سایت در مرورگر های مختلف
    نوشته شده توسط mnfun65 در بخش ASP.NET Web Forms
    پاسخ: 2
    آخرین پست: یک شنبه 12 خرداد 1392, 17:08 عصر
  2. سوال: نحوه ثابت ماندن header با تغییر سایز پنجره مرورگر
    نوشته شده توسط sahel65 در بخش طراحی وب (Web Design)
    پاسخ: 5
    آخرین پست: پنج شنبه 19 مرداد 1391, 15:04 عصر
  3. تازه می خوامم یاد بگیرم
    نوشته شده توسط sunboy در بخش برنامه نویسی با زبان C و ++C
    پاسخ: 13
    آخرین پست: شنبه 28 خرداد 1384, 11:22 صبح
  4. ثابت ماندن مقدار انتخابی dropdownlist
    نوشته شده توسط tazekar در بخش ASP.NET Web Forms
    پاسخ: 6
    آخرین پست: چهارشنبه 02 مهر 1382, 14:38 عصر

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•